General Description
2,4,6-Tris(phenylazo)phenol, also known as Brilliant Pink B, is an organic compound commonly used as a pH indicator and in the production of dyes. It is a member of the azo compound family, characterized by the presence of one or more nitrogen-nitrogen double bonds. This chemical is of interest due to its vibrant pink color and its ability to undergo color changes in response to pH levels, making it valuable in various laboratory and industrial applications. Additionally, it has been studied for its potential use in drug delivery systems and as a photochromic material. However, caution is advised when handling this compound, as it is a known skin and eye irritant and may pose environmental hazards.
Check Digit Verification of cas no
The CAS Registry Mumber 13014-91-0 includes 8 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 5 digits, 1,3,0,1 and 4 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 9 and 1 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 13014-91:
(7*1)+(6*3)+(5*0)+(4*1)+(3*4)+(2*9)+(1*1)=60
60 % 10 = 0
So 13014-91-0 is a valid CAS Registry Number.
